What does 5-2-0=3 mean?
5-2-0=3 is a mathematical equation, which means that the result of subtracting 2 from 5 and then subtracting 0 is equal to 3.

A mathematical equation is a mathematical statement that represents the equal relationship between two numbers or expressions. In this equation, 5-2-0 is to subtract 2 from 5 and then subtract 0 from the result, and the final result is 3. This equation can be verified by simple calculation: 5-2=3, 3-0=3, so the result of 5-2-0 is 3.
